Janet Clark Shay Writing is like physical exercise. The more you do it, the more you want to do it! Sometimes the writing needs to come even before the inspiration arrives. The hardest part of physical exercise is those first few days when you're out of shape, out of breath, and in general have little inspiration. As with physical exercise, so it is with writing. The energy, the excitement, and the fulfillment all grow as we keep on the move.
Janet Clark Shay The only way I deal with writer's block is to tackle it by writing. When left to grow on its own, writer's block eventually stops me from writing altogether. Take a short break, perhaps even a few days rest, but write even when you seemingly have nothing to write about. Work through it, or it will kill your ambition to write.
Janet Clark Shay If I could answer only one question about writing, it would be without a doubt to write something every day. Don't wait until you are in the mood. Write. Our writing grows by writing, not merely by thinking about what we're going to write someday.
